Flask concurrency
Web在多线程时,Flask错误建议使用app_context--但这不起作用. 浏览 47 关注 0 回答 1 得票数 0. 原文. 我已经创建了一条路由来测试发送电子邮件。. 当访问/book_blast时,我得到一个运行时错误。. 我用不同的方法添加了app_context (),但没有一种方法能消除这个错误。. 如果 ... WebConcurrent asynchronous processes with Python, Flask and Celery. I am working on a small but computationally-intensive Python app. The computationally-intensive work can …
Flask concurrency
Did you know?
WebThis idea of asynchronous code described above is also sometimes called "concurrency". It is different from "parallelism". Concurrency and parallelism both relate to "different things happening more or less at the same time". But the details between concurrency and parallelism are quite different. WebFutures¶. flask_executor.FutureProxy objects look and behave like normal concurrent.futures.Future objects, but allow flask_executor to override certain methods and add additional behaviours. When submitting a callable to add_done_callback(), callables are wrapped with a copy of both the current application context and current request context.. …
WebFeb 8, 2024 · Flask and Concurrency We’ll be using Flask as a part of a simple application to experiment with. It’s a micro web framework built in Python, and designed to be used for small applications.... WebThe first argument is the function that should be called when the signal is emitted, the optional second argument specifies a sender. To unsubscribe from a signal, you can use the disconnect () method. For all core Flask signals, the …
WebJun 27, 2024 · For Flask: Concurrency Level: 500 Time taken for tests: 27.827 seconds Complete requests: 5000 Failed requests: 0 Total transferred: 830000 bytes HTML transferred: 105000 bytes Requests per second: 179.68 [#/sec] (mean) Time per request: 2782.653 [ms] (mean) Time per request: 5.565 [ms] (mean, across all concurrent … WebThe Flask class has many methods designed for subclassing. You can quickly add or customize behavior by subclassing Flask (see the linked method docs) and using that …
WebAug 17, 2024 · Flask-Executor is an easy to use wrapper for the concurrent.futures module that lets you initialise and configure executors via common Flask application patterns. It's a great way to get up and running fast with a lightweight in-process task queue. Installation Flask-Executor is available on PyPI and can be installed with:
WebMar 28, 2024 · Async in flask can also be achieved by using threads (concurrency) or multiprocessing (parallelism) or from tools like Celery or RQ: Asynchronous Tasks with Flask and Celery; Asynchronous Tasks with Flask and Redis Queue; FastAPI. FastAPI greatly simplifies asynchronous tasks due to it's native support for asyncio. teresa lake obituaryWebApr 12, 2024 · flask-executor:向 Flask 添加 concurrent.futures 支持 05-29 Flask -Executor ...这是在 Flask 应用 程序 中 使用 Flask -Executor 的快速示例: from flask import Flask from flask _executor import Executor app = Flask ( __name__ ) … teresa lamanaWebApr 6, 2024 · the worker needs to have only one process (–concurrency 1) How does it work? Well, a single worker process ensures there is exactly one task processed at a time. If for some reason task takes longer than anticipated (e.g. longer than intervals for Celery Beat scheduler), another one is not started. It may still pile up in the broker, though. teresa lamantiaWebIn order to set the environment and debug mode reliably, Flask uses environment variables. The environment is used to indicate to Flask, extensions, and other programs, like Sentry, what context Flask is running in. It is controlled with the FLASK_ENV environment variable and defaults to production. teresa lamayWebNov 14, 2024 · Flask with Waitress Server Software: waitress Server Hostname: 127.0.0.1 Server Port: 8000 Document Path: / Document Length: 21 bytes Concurrency Level: 1000 Time taken for tests: 3.403 seconds... teresa lake great basin national parkWebJun 16, 2024 · However, Flask is fundamentally constrained in that it is a WSGI application. So whilst in newer versions of Flask (2.x) you can get a performance boost by making use of an event loop within path operations, your Flask server will still tie up a worker for each request. FastAPI on the other hand implements the ASGI specification. teresa lamastersWebDec 27, 2024 · Having such a workload, we will play with different methods of achieving high concurrency in the Flask's handling of HTTP requests. First, we need to emulate a slow … teresa lambert